    User: a customer from yahoo.com

    Submitted: 10/11/2005

    Style of Music: progressive, jazz, alternative

    Experience: active musician, sound technician

    Location: Brezice, Slovenia, Europe

    "Great bass for the money!"

    Feature:
    Nice carved body which is IMO best looking from Ibanezes! The hardware is just excelent...And the mono rail bridges are amazing!

    Quality:
    IMO the quality of Ibaneze basses is shown here. Except for the Ibanez Prestige series!

    Value:
    This item is apsolutely wort of buying. For that price you won't get anythig better!

    Sound:
    For the money this bass costs the sound is amazing and it has so much versatile options, so you can make your own sound of it! It also has 18v active electronics so that is a big +! Only - here is that the bass don't have much of an output and that the knobs get useb verry quick!

    Support:
    I didn't have any special problems than just output of it!
